2016-11-25 28 views
0

我必須使用Sqoop在HDFS中攝取CSV文件。使用SQOOP的數據攝取

問題是我正在使用','(逗號)作爲分隔符,而且我的數據也有','的列。這是創建解析數據的問題。

任何人都可以建議我該怎麼做才能解決問題?

我可以使用SQOOP嗎?

回答

0

當使用sqoop將數據導入hdfs時,可以使用sqoop特定參數--fields-terminated-by來分隔字段。

如果您試圖從本地文件系統導入csv文件,那麼在這種情況下,您可以直接使用hadoop fs -put命令將其文件放入hdfs中。

+0

謝謝,我想從我的Mysql數據庫導入csv文件到hdfs使用sqoop – Rani